Northern Garrett is  a perfect 6-0 against Hancock since September of 2017 and they'll have a chance to extend that dominance on Wednesday. The Huskies will host the Panthers  at 7:00  p.m. The teams are on pretty different trajectories at the moment (Northern Garrett has ten straight  victories, Hancock has six straight  losses), but none of that matters once you're on the court.

If Keyser wanted to avenge their loss from the last time they played Northern Garrett, they should've done a better job of containing  Violet Taylor. The Huskies put the hurt on the Golden Tornado with a sharp  3-0 win on Tuesday thanks in part to  Taylor, who  had 15  digs and two  assists. She has been hot, having  posted 14 or more  digs the last six times she's  played.
 Northern Garrett not only won, but also showed off some consistency: they kept Keyser between 13 and 16 points across their sets.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-14, 25-16,  25-13.
Meanwhile, Hancock came up short against Southern Fulton on Monday and fell  3-1.
 The final score came out to 25-12, 17-25, 25-21,  25-14.
 Hancock's defeat dropped their record down to 0-5. As for Northern Garrett, their victory bumped their record up to 10-0.
 Everything went Northern Garrett's way against Hancock in their previous meeting  back in October of 2024, as Northern Garrett made off with  a  3-0 win. Do  the Huskies have another victory up their sleeve, or will the Panthers turn the tables on them?  We'll have the answer soon enough.
